    3. Hello everyone, Some bodies were reburied in Milton Cemetery. Others (including two of my own ancestors) are still there - under the tarmac. Check with Portsmouth City Cemeteries Office (in Milton Cemetery) - they can tell you who's where if you give them the name(s) of the deceased. Ken. Mike The simple answer is that not all graves had headstones - not sure if you have access to the MI's (available in transcript at the Hampshire RO or on fiche from the HGS) but they should tell you whether there was headstone. Over the years, some stones have been deemed unsafe or have been vandalised and so may have been removed. The Portsmouth Bereavement service based at Milton Cemetery Office should be able to assist. Hi Shirley Back in the 1980's a few body's were removed to make way for a Lorry weigh bridge for Commodore Shipping Co Then I believe Portsmouth City Council advertised in the local paper that a car park would be built on the site and I think if you wanted you could have your relative removed. But most are still there. Very sad as I think the land was given to the City as long as it remained a green space!!!!!!
